Autism Resources in Jefferson County, Ohio
Local providers, school contacts, and support services for autism families in Jefferson County. Ohio statewide resources also apply.
Jefferson County — home to Steubenville, Wintersville, and Toronto — is in far eastern Ohio near the West Virginia and Pennsylvania borders. The Jefferson County Board of Developmental Disabilities coordinates Level One and Transitions waivers. Families often access providers in Weirton, WV or Pittsburgh, PA as well as Cleveland for specialized evaluations. Help Me Grow serves children under 3, and OCECD provides free IEP advocacy statewide.

Steubenville
Trinity Health System — Pediatric Developmental Services
Trinity Health System in Steubenville is the primary regional hospital for Jefferson County and the Ohio Valley area. Their pediatric services include developmental screenings and autism evaluation referrals. Steubenville families sometimes access Pittsburgh-area children's hospitals (UPMC Children's Hospital of Pittsburgh, ~40 miles east) for comprehensive autism workups.
UPMC Children's Hospital of Pittsburgh (~40 miles) is a strong referral option given Jefferson County's proximity to Pennsylvania.

Steubenville
Jefferson County Help Me Grow — Early Intervention
Ohio's Help Me Grow early intervention for Jefferson County children birth to age 3. Free evaluations and in-home therapy for children with developmental delays. No diagnosis required for evaluation.
FREE under IDEA Part C. No diagnosis required — call as soon as you have developmental concerns.

Steubenville
Jefferson County Board of Developmental Disabilities
Jefferson County's DD Board provides service coordination, eligibility determination, and connection to county and state-funded disability supports. The gateway to Ohio's developmental disability service system for Steubenville and surrounding Ohio Valley communities.
Ohio county DD Boards are unique. Apply early for HCBS waiver services.
